With Phase 1 of a citywide sound study approaching completion, Siebein Acoustic, the City’s sound consultant, is inviting residents, business owners, and visitors to share their experiences through a brief online survey.
Siebein Acoustic staff have spent the summer conducting field measurements, gathering technical data, meeting with community members, and visiting locations across Sarasota to better understand how sound is perceived in different areas and at different times. The survey asks participants to describe the types of sounds they encounter, both acceptable and unacceptable, and provide information about when and where those sounds occur, how long they last, and how they affect individuals’ ability to use or enjoy an area.
The consultant will present its Phase 1 findings to the City Commission in September. Survey responses will be reviewed alongside acoustic measurements, field observations, and other technical data as Commissioners consider whether additional study is warranted and potential updates to the City’s sound ordinance.
